Gasafier turns the wood into a gas mix mostly hydrogen (or so im told) this gets filtered and run throught a generator. typically a genny designed for propane but a gas generator can work too by removing the carb and basically making your own, either with simple hand turned butterfly valves, or you can do oxygen sensing stuff, servos and an Arduino or something like that.

Carbon neutral because the trees being burned got there mass by absorbing carbon from the air, so burning it would be returning it back to the air. maybe carbon neutral-ish is a better descriptor

Carbon neutral because the trees being burned got there mass by absorbing carbon from the air, so burning it would be returning it back to the air. maybe carbon neutral-ish is a better descriptor
Carbon neutral because the gasoline being burned got its mass by absorbing carbon from the air, so burning it would be returning it back to the air.

So it is actually no more carbon neutral than using gasoline UNLESS for every mole of carbon dioxide you produce you grow, within a short period of time, trees that contain an equal number of moles of carbon. You have described the carbon cycle. It can stay in equilibrium for ever as long as the partition of carbon between wood and similar "fuels" on/in the ground and in CO2 in the atmosphere stays in balance. If we release CO2 that was trapped millions of years ago and instead of growing vegetation to reabsorb and return that to earth instead cut down the trees that can do that job obviously the equilibrium moves in the wrong direction.

I still think it's easier to do a solar system. Buy some panels, put them on a frame, wire them up an connect to an inverter. Plug the car into the inverter.
